Weight and Pulse Rate

Show scatter plots and all details (correlation coefficient, label axis, etc.) Explain the relationship between variable of the plot using the correlation coefficient. Also show the linear equation and interpret the slope.

Homework Answers

Answer #1

The correlation coefficient r = 0.082 which is a positive value which signifies that increase in weight increases the pulse rate. But here in this case the coefficient is close to zero we consider there is very much less correlation which means significantly there is no correlation.

The simple linear regression equation is

Y = 0.0503X + 67.659

Here the slope is 0.0503 which says that increase in 1 unit of weight increses the pulse rate by 0.05 units.
